Dear All, Computer Training and Spoken English Programme at Divya Jyothi Charitable Trust, Mysore
Divya Jyothi Charitable Trust, Mysore, is offering courses in Computer Training, Spoken English, Braille teaching (manual and brailler), Personality development, Mobility training, Home management, Chess and gymnasium for visually impaired students, free of charge. The course duration is One Year, starting from April 2014 to March 2015. The date of commencement is 21 April 2014. The course covers: 1. Basic spoken English 2. Computer operations such as: a. English computer typewriting (40 WPM) b. Working with files and folders c. Creating and managing user accounts d. CD/DVD burning, scanning books on Windows XP and Windows 7 operating systems e. MS Office 2007 applications such as MS Word, MS Excel, MS PowerPoint f. Configuring Outlook express g. Use of E-mails h. Internet browsers; Internet Explorer, Mozilla Firefox etc. i. Instant messaging, voice messaging j. Using applications for screen readers such as JAWS13, NVDA, Kurzweil operation, and E-speak for regional language. k. Dropbox. l. Accessing social websites. The One Year course includes counselling for employment training, career guidance, soft skills and personality development. Faculty: Many eminent personalities in professional training, skills development, and employment counseling would be involved in guiding and assisting the candidates during the training program. Through computer literacy and spoken English training, the course aims to enhance the candidate's employment prospects and all round development. Eligibility criteria: 1.
